r. We can read specific records from internal table by providing the table index number or key value. Loop at it_tabla where lgart = '0100' or lgart = '0200' or lgart = Hello, Many of you already know to work with For loop in SAP ABAP. Then create 2 table types We don't require all the data from the table too often, but, quite often, we do need to get some fields from the table where they have a number of values. This was introduced way back in 2013, My approach was to add 2 structures ZMATN_STR and ZCHARG_STR to the dictionary with associated components as line (MATNR, CHARG). Suggestion: Why don'y you use FOR ALL ENTRIES in Hi, gurus, I have requirement where I have multiple KSCHL (condition types) in bset table. It is also useful to change data in any column of internal table. The internal table itab is filled with data and the first line of a set of lines is searched that is located pretty much at the bottom of the table. I am situated in the IT department of a multi national chemical Read statement will read internal tables record one by one for the condition you have given. 4 syntax often Hi, How can I read internal table with key not equal to some other field. Solved: Hello, I want to reading internal table as follows: READ TABLE i_cust WITH KEY domvalue = it_kna1-NAME1. In this case, the WHERE condition how to implement dynamic WHERE conditions in SAP ABAP database queries. I want to read the same table with or condition in key In this post, you will learn about the new read syntax introduced in ABAP release 7. Messages of the code inspector regarding the bypassing of the table buffer I really miss arrays in ABAP - it sometimes feels like you need way more code to get the same results as in other languages :D @user9597084 Internal tables in ABAP are arrays @lausek But place isn't a unique key in my case, nor is it_itab a SORTED TABLE. If a sorted table or a hashed table is accessed using the primary table key, the full WHERE condition is applied to each line of the table that is relevant for the current statement. I have written the select query with the Unlike READ TABLE, the statement SELECT offers a (dynamic) WHERE condition and evaluates the field list for the inline declaration. The key value provided for reading the line is called as Search Key. The statement is executed on the AS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. . actully, i got an inefficient logic to count the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. READ TABLE Solved: Good afternoon, I have the following issue, I have that do a LOOP to a table Internal, ie. Internal table itab got more than 1000 records,now i need to get the number of records with condition that itab-field1 = 'XXXX'. 40. Basically in read statement we can read only fields equal to others fields. In this post, you will learn about the new read syntax introduced in ABAP release 7. However, those who are new to the ABAP 7. On SQL Hi Folks, I had declared a range for s_witht and wanna read the table tempx w. About 40% of the rows are not relevant to me because I only need the entries with PAR1 = "XYZ". The example shows that searching with a WHERE If you are reading the internal table with unique key field probably you can have IF Condition check after READ statement. Optimize data retrieval with flexible and efficient query building An SAP table query can use the SQL IN operator to specify a list or range of field values in a WHERE clause. loop at printtab. This was introduced way back in 2013,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. Reading of all objects in the ABAP keyword documentation from the table DOKIL using a suitable WHERE condition. Imagine I want to get all entries from an internal table (STANDARD TABLE OF) where place is ABAP is not my first and only programing language and I tends not to think in "dynamic table solution" . t to the belnr in printtab and range of values declared in s_witht. If multiple lines of an internal table are to be read, the statement LOOP generally has better performance than I get a internal table from a Function Module call that returns ~ 100 rows. It is useful when used in conjunction with a job parameter to pass values at If a sorted table or a hashed table is accessed using the primary table key, the full WHERE condition is applied to each line of the table that is relevant for the current statement. that we can do by Internal tables can also be specified as a data source of a query in ABAP SQL.
i0kkxyrti4
aicudmyez
4hz1jdf0uo
egqrduj
5gceb
g1wp5vyozs
tugox
ir2wclxumc
edfsogj
4obr5sz
i0kkxyrti4
aicudmyez
4hz1jdf0uo
egqrduj
5gceb
g1wp5vyozs
tugox
ir2wclxumc
edfsogj
4obr5sz